There was a time when my prayers felt tangled inside my chest …too heavy to speak and too fragile to share. Words stayed trapped between my thoughts and my heart. But when I began writing my prayers, something gentle and healing started to unfold within me.

Putting pen to paper slowed my rushing mind and created space for honesty. On the page, I didn’t need perfect words or polished faith. I could bring my fears, my gratitude, my questions, and even my silence. Writing became a sacred pause, a place where my soul could breathe and where I felt seen by God in the most tender way.

Over time, I noticed that the act of writing prayers softened my anxiety, clarified my thoughts, and helped me release burdens I had been carrying alone. What once felt overwhelming became surrender. What once felt chaotic became peace. When I look back through my pages, I see not only my struggles, but also God’s faithfulness woven through every season.

Writing prayers has become medicine for my soul, a quiet rhythm of healing, trust, and renewal. It reminds me that I don’t have to carry everything inside; I can lay it down, one word at a time.

If your heart feels heavy, restless, or unsure of how to pray, try beginning with a single sentence. Start where you are. God meets us in honesty, not perfection, and sometimes healing begins with ink, paper, and a willing heart.
